How they compare
Kyrgyzstan currently reports 7.3% against 7.2% in Saint Kitts and Nevis, a difference of 0.1%.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 24 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Kyrgyzstan ahead.
Kyrgyzstan ranks 137th and Saint Kitts and Nevis ranks 140th of 194 countries.
Kyrgyzstan has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Kyrgyzstan | Saint Kitts and Nevis |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 9.7% | 6.3% | 3.4% | Kyrgyzstan |
| 2010s | 8.1% | 7.1% | 1.1% | Kyrgyzstan |
| 2020s | 7.7% | 7.5% | 0.2% | Kyrgyzstan |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
